I have so far traced my wifes Wheeler family back to about 1767 in Somerset but there Is a more recent connection to Malta I would like to explore.

I have George Wheeler, born Bristol abt Dec 1844, in the1871 census he is a Corporal in the Army Service Corps; RG 10 / 2041 / 63 / p 14.

George Wheeler married Clara Jones in Dec 1874 in Portsea, Hants., and their first child, Anne, is born 187 5in Portsmouth.

It appears that he was deployed o Malta where three other children were born, of whom two sadly died: Minnie born 1878 died1880, Richard born 1879 died 1880 and Frederick born 1880.

In the1881census, v, he is back in Cheshire as a Warrant Officer.

However, it is the Malta years I would like to find more information on; the dates of births and deaths, were the two 1880deaths connected?

Cananyone help, or point me in the right direction?

Baptisms
Garrison Church, Malta
Parents George, Staff Sergeant A S C & Clara Wheeler
Minnie Wheeler born 3rd May 1878 & baptised 19th May 1878
Richard Wheeler born 27th June 1879 & baptised 27th July 1879
Frederick Wheeler born 13th October 1880 & baptised 29th October 1880
Residence for first two was Valletta and last was Sliema
